#include "arm_compute/runtime/NEON/functions/NEHistogram.h"

#include "arm_compute/core/Error.h"
#include "arm_compute/core/IDistribution1D.h"
#include "arm_compute/core/ITensor.h"
#include "arm_compute/core/TensorInfo.h"
#include "arm_compute/core/Validate.h"
#include "arm_compute/runtime/NEON/NEScheduler.h"
#include "support/ToolchainSupport.h"

using namespace arm_compute;

NEHistogram::NEHistogram()
    : _histogram_kernel(), _local_hist(), _window_lut(window_lut_default_size), _local_hist_size(0)
{
}

void NEHistogram::configure(const IImage *input, IDistribution1D *output)
{
    ARM_COMPUTE_ERROR_ON_TENSOR_NOT_2D(input);
    ARM_COMPUTE_ERROR_ON(nullptr == output);

    // Allocate space for threads local histograms
    _local_hist_size = output->num_bins() * NEScheduler::get().num_threads();
    _local_hist.resize(_local_hist_size);

    // Configure kernel
    _histogram_kernel.configure(input, output, _local_hist.data(), _window_lut.data());
}

void NEHistogram::run()
{
    // Calculate histogram of input.
    NEScheduler::get().schedule(&_histogram_kernel, Window::DimY);
}
